Domitiana, derived from the Latin 'Dominus', meaning 'of the lord', carries connotations of nobility, leadership, and divine favor. Historically, it was associated with Roman aristocracy, reflecting strength and grace. The name is rare yet elegant, embodying a timeless sense of dignity and authority.
